Why Xiaomi is blocking the installation of games SD-map?
The reason lies in the architecture of Android and Google's policy, since Android 6.0 Marshmallow, the system supports two modes of operation. SD-map:
- ๐ Portable Storage โ The card is used as a removable drive (photos, music, documents) and games and applications are installed only in internal memory.
- ๐ Adoptable Storage โ The card is formatted as part of the system memory, but Xiaomi has disabled this mode. MIUI Due to the risk of data loss and slowdown.
In addition, game manufacturers often prohibit installation on SD due to:
- ๐ก๏ธ Piracy protections โ itโs easier to control internal storage licenses.
- โก Productivity โ SD-cards (especially class) UHS-I or lower) are slower than the internal memory UFS 2.2/3.1.
- ๐ Security - data on SD easier to copy or replace.
โ ๏ธ Note: If the game requires a permanent Internet connection (for example, PUBG Mobile or Free Fire, it may refuse to work SD-maps even after successful installation. Before transfer, check the game requirements on Google Play.
Method 1: Formatting SD-Cards as internal memory (for advanced memory)
This is the most reliable way, but it has critical drawbacks: once formatted, the card cannot be retrieved without losing data, and it will be โtiedโ to a particular phone, only suitable for A1/A2 cards (such as the SanDisk Extreme or Samsung EVO Plus) with a volume of 64 GB.
Instructions:
- Put it in. SD-card to your phone and wait for it to be recognized.
- Go to Settings. โ Memory. โ SD-map.
- Slip on the three dots in the top right corner and select Storage Settings.
- Click Format as Internal โ Clean and Format.
- After the process is complete, restart the phone.
Now, when you install games, the system will suggest you choose a save location, and it's important that you don't use the card in other devices without being cleaned.

Method 2: Post-installation transfer (official method)
If the previous method seems risky, use the built-in MIUI feature, which does not allow you to install the game directly on the SD, but transfers some files after installation, does not work for all games, but is supported by most offline projects.
Step-by-step:
- Set the game in a standard way (into internal memory).
- Go to Settings โ Applications โ Application Management.
- Find the game in the list and tap it.
- Select Warehouse. โ Change.
- Indicate. SD-map and confirm the transfer.
Note that only a fraction of the data (usually cache and additional files) will be transferred, and the main.apk file will remain in internal memory. For heavy games like Asphalt 9, this will free up 1-3 GB.
| Game. | Portable data | Saving memory |
|---|---|---|
| Genshin Impact | Cash, texture packs. | ~2.5 GB |
| Call of Duty Mobile | Additional resources | ~1.2 GB |
| Minecraft | Worlds, textures | ~500MB |
| Asphalt 9 | Graphics, sounds | ~1.8 GB |
โ ๏ธ Note: Some games (such as Honor of Kings or League of Legends: Wild Rift) block data transfer to the Internet. SD In this case, only the method of formatting the card as internal memory will help.

Method 3: Using ADB to Force SD Installation
For power users, there's a way to trick the system with Android Debug Bridge (ADB). It allows you to forcefully indicate SD-The default installation location is the map, and it requires you to connect your phone to your PC and have a basic command line knowledge.
Instructions:
- Download and install ADB Tools on PC.
- On your phone, activate Developer Mode (7 times tap the MIUI version in Settings โ About Phone) and turn on Debugging over USB.
- Connect the phone to the PC and type in the command line:
adb shell pm set-install-location 2This command forces the system to install applications on SD-The default card. To return the settings to the original state, use:
adb shell pm set-install-location 0The advantage of the method: works for most games, even those that block the transfer through the menu.

Before using ADB, check if your Xiaomi model supports pm set-install-location. On some firmware, it is disabled - in this case, only the root or custom recaveri will help.
Which games will not work with SD-map?
Even if you manage to install the game on an external drive, some projects will not start. Here is a list of categories of games for which the transfer is guaranteed to not work:
- ๐ฎ Online shooters with anti-cheat (PUBG Mobile, Free Fire, Call of Duty Mobile โ Blocking Launch from the Internet SD Due to the risk of file modification.
- ๐ Games with DRM-protection (NBA 2K Mobile, FIFA Mobile โ require verification of the internal storage license.
- ๐ Frequently updated games (Clash of Clans, Brawl Stars) โ updates can break the work when installed on the site SD.
- ๐ญ Games with high reading speed requirements (Genshin Impact, Honkai: Star Rail) โ SD-The cards do not provide sufficient loading speed of textures.
If your game falls into one of these categories, itโs best not to waste time on portability.

How to choose SD-map?
Not every microSD is good for installing games, cheap C10 or U1 cards will slow down levels and cause lags, and you need a drive with the following characteristics to play comfortably.
| Parameter | Minimum requirement | Recommended value |
|---|---|---|
| Class speed | A1 | A2 (or UHS-I U3) |
| Volume. | 32GB | 128 GB+ |
| Reading speed | 90 MB/s | 150 MB/s + |
| Recording speed | 30 MB/s | 90 MB/s+ |
| Brand | Anybody. | SanDisk Extreme, Samsung EVO Plus, Lexar Play |
Examples of suitable maps:
- ๐พ SanDisk Extreme microSDXC UHS-I A2 128GB โ Best choice for price/quality.
- ๐พ Samsung EVO Plus microSDXC UHS-I U3 256GB โ reliability and high speed.
- ๐พ Lexar Play microSDXC UHS-I A2 512GB โ For those who have a lot of heavy games.
Before buying, check the card for authenticity with apps like SD Insight โ the market is flooded with fakes that pretend to be A2 but work like C10.

Frequent Mistakes and How to Avoid Them
When migrating games to SD, Xiaomi users often face typical problems, and here are the most common ways to solve them:
- ๐ซ "Insufficient space on the device when installed on SD Reason: The card is formatted as portable, not internal.Solution: Use Method 1 (formatting as internal memory) or Method 3 (ADB).
- ๐ The game is dyed after being transferred to SD Reason: Low card read speed or anti-cheat lock Solution: Return the game to internal memory or buy a class card A2.
- ๐ฑ After extraction SD The card was connected as an internal memory and the data is tied to it.Solution: Do not retrieve the card without first transferring the data back.
- โ ๏ธ "Application not installed" after transfer Reason: Damaged files or incompatibility with SD. Solution: Remove the game and reinstall it by selecting internal memory.
โ ๏ธ Note: If you have used Method 3 (ADB) And after you reboot the phone, the games are reset into internal memory, repeat the command. MIUI Reset the installation settings after rebooting.
